Output e39d075b5bbaba2d49aecdd90ee230bfb9e309cd083fd5bf0addfb19d83afd83:0

value
462358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ee0b64b24db8899b21eba8f2c7055b571be31231 OP_EQUAL
address
3PPgPpgbLDYu7MH7XV6WqakZ1GeXAQGR1Q
transaction
e39d075b5bbaba2d49aecdd90ee230bfb9e309cd083fd5bf0addfb19d83afd83
confirmations
210583
spent
true